RUSSIA. Leading premium vodka brand Russian Standard has named Dmitry Shirshov as its new Vice President of Marketing & Sales. Shirshov will be responsible for key marketing initiatives and sales development for the Russian Standard Vodka portfolio of brands – Russian Standard Original, Russian Standard Platinum and Imperia – as well as for the premium brands imported into Russia by the company’s distribution arm, Roust Inc.
Shirshov’s primary duties will involve integrating the group’s marketing efforts and developing a consistent sales system across Russian Standard’s global footprint.
“I have always admired Russian Standard’s entrepreneurial spirit and ambition to transition from the category leader in Russia to the global leader in the premium vodka market,” said Shirshov. “I am very enthusiastic about the opportunity to work with the Russian Standard team both internationally and at home in Russia, where the company’s agency brands are market leaders.”
Carlo Radicati, Chief Executive Officer of Russian Standard’s alcohol businesses, said, “We are excited to welcome Dmitry onto our team. His energy and experience in marketing and sales development will be critical to the continued international growth and success of our brands. I am confident he will do very well in his new role and be instrumental in the development of our company. ”
Before joining Russian Standard, Shirshov worked for three years as Brand Development Director at Scottish & Newcastle, where most recently he was responsible for the international business development of the S&N cider portfolio (Strongbow, Bulmers) and Foster’s European brand management.
He also served as Brand Development Director responsible for the Asian region of S&N (including China, India, Vietnam) from 2005-2006. From 2002-2005, Shirshov worked as Marketing Director of VENA Brewery – part of Baltic Beverages Holding. In addition to that role, in 2005 Shirshov served as a Project Team Leader during the consolidation project of the Russian business of BBH into a single structure under Baltika Brewing Company.
He also served as Sales & Marketing Manager of Baltic Beverages for Russia in 2001-2002. His earlier work included marketing roles at Mars and RJR Tobacco.
Dmitry Shirshov has a degree in Economics from Moscow State University and an MBA from The Ohio State University.
Russian Standard Vodkas are currently available in over 50 markets worldwide. In the last year Russian Standard Vodka has launched in key new markets such as Greece, Ireland, France and the UK. Additional launches are planned throughout Asia and South America in 2008.
About Russian Standard Vodka
The Russian Standard vodka portfolio dominates the premium segment in Russia with a 60% market share and sales of over 1.9 million cases per year in Russia and over 50 export markets across Europe, the US and Asia. Roustam Tariko, the founder of Russian Standard, introduced Russian Standard Original in 1998 as the first authentic Russian premium vodka. Two years after launch, sales of Russian Standard Original surpassed all imported premium vodkas on the Russian market, leading to broad international expansion and the launch of Russian Standard Platinum in 2001, and Imperia Vodka, the company’s luxury brand, in 2004.
About Roust Inc.
Founded in 1992 by Roustam Tariko, Roust Inc. is among the country’s leading importers of premium spirits, including Campari, Grant’s & Glenfiddich, Remy Martin, Piper Heidsieck, Cinzano and Jagermeister.
